What is the Goethe-Zertifikat? The Goethe-Zertifikat is a German language evaluation for non-native speakers. It is diligently aligned with the Common European Framework of Reference for Languages (CEFR), which varies from level A1 (beginners) to C2 (sophisticated proficiency). Whether a person is seeking to study in Germany, sign up with a family member through family reunification visas, or boost their business resume, having an acknowledged language certificate is compulsory. Introduction of Goethe-Zertifikat Levels CEFR Level Description Common Use Cases A1/ A2 Standard Language Use Household reunification visas, primary communication. B1/ B2 Independent Language Use Trade training, operating in Germany, particular citizenship requirements. C1/ C2 Proficient Language Use University admission, advanced professional environments, scholastic research study. Step-by-Step Guide to Getting Your Certificate Legitimately Getting the certificate properly includes structured preparation and official registration. Here is the roadmap to success: 1. Identify Your Required Level Before scheduling a test, prospects need to determine which level they need. Studying at a German university? Usually needs TestDaF or Goethe-Zertifikat C1. Obtaining a standard work or spousal visa? Generally requires A1 or B1. 2. Prepare Thoroughly Passing a Goethe exam requires mastering four core linguistic abilities: Reading (Lesen): Comprehending short articles, letters, and literature. Listening (Hören): Understanding daily discussions, radio broadcasts, and lectures. Writing (Schreiben): Drafting official and informal letters, essays, or commentaries. Speaking (Sprechen): Participating in structured dialogues, presenting a topic, and discussing. 3. Register by means of Official Channels Evaluations can be booked directly through the main https://www.goethe.de or through certified evaluation centers worldwide. Suggested Preparation Materials To guarantee success on the first effort, candidates must utilize main study help: Model Tests (Modellsätze): Free downloadable practice tests offered directly on the Goethe-Institut website. Prep Books: Publications from significant publishers like Hueber or Klett particularly customized to the Goethe-Zertifikat format. Language Schools: Enrolling in recognized extensive language courses either online or in-person. What to Expect on Exam Day Knowing what takes place on the day of the test can substantially minimize anxiety. The format usually consists of written examinations in the early morning, followed by an oral assessment (either separately or in pairs) in the afternoon. Identification: Candidates need to provide a valid, government-issued image ID (passport or national identity card). Environment: Strict anti-cheating procedures are imposed. Electronic gadgets are strictly prohibited in the testing room. Grading: Papers are graded according to stringent, standardized international rubrics to ensure fairness and consistency.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) 1. Can I take the Goethe-Zertifikat exam online? While some preparation courses are digital, a lot of main Goethe-Zertifikat exams should be taken face to face at a licensed Goethe-Institut or partner examination center to guarantee safe and secure identity confirmation and standardized testing conditions. However, the Goethe-Institut does use Goethe-Zertifikat A1 to B2 digital alternatives at selected certified test centers where candidates take the composed portion on a computer system. 2. The length of time is a Goethe-Zertifikat valid? Unlike some other language certificates that end after 2 years, the Goethe-Zertifikat does not have an expiration date. It stays legitimate for life. However, please note that some universities or companies may separately request a certificate gotten within the last 2 to 3 years to ensure your language abilities depend on date. 3. What occurs if I stop working one part of the examination? Historically, you had to retake the entire examination. Nevertheless, the Goethe-Institut now uses modular exams for levels A1 through C2. If you stop working only one module (e.g., Speaking or Writing), you can retake just that specific module within a designated timeframe, saving both time and cash. 4. The length of time does it require to get the outcomes? Results are generally released in between 1 to 3 weeks after the assessment date, depending on the particular exam center and the level checked. Once graded, you can gather your authorities certificate in individual or have it mailed to you. 5. Are Goethe certificates accepted worldwide? Yes. Due to the fact that the Goethe-Institut operates under the cultural remit of the Federal Republic of Germany and adheres strictly to CEFR standards, its certificates delight in universal acknowledgment by academic organizations, corporate companies, and federal government authorities globally.
